Professional Summary
Assistant Professor (Tenure-Track) at Aalborg University, affiliated with the Edge Computing and Networking Group, the CMI Section, and the Department of Electronic Systems. Research interests include memristive computing architectures for edge intelligence, device modeling, stochastic phenomena in resistive switching systems, cellular nonlinear networks, neuromorphic circuits, and cellular automata.
